Over Williamston
Over Williamston is a farm in West Lothian, Scotland. Over Williamston is situated nearby to Balgreen Service Reservoir, as well as near Harperrig Reservoir.Places of Interest Nearby

Livingston South railway station
Railway station
Photo: Nigel Thompson,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Livingston South railway station is one of two railway stations serving the town of Livingston in West Lothian, Scotland. It is located on the Shotts Line, 14 miles west of Edinburgh Waverley on the way to Glasgow Central. Livingston South railway station is situated 2½ miles north of Over Williamston.
Harperrig Reservoir
Reservoir
Photo: james denham,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Harperrig Reservoir is a reservoir in West Lothian, Scotland, to the north of the Pentland Hills, four miles south of Mid Calder. The Water of Leith flows through it, and nearby are Harlaw Reservoir and Threipmuir Reservoir. Harperrig Reservoir is situated 2½ miles east of Over Williamston.
Cairns Castle
Ruins
Photo: Richard Webb,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Cairns Castle is a ruined keep, dating from the 15th century. It is located on the northern slope of the Pentland Hills, around 6.5 miles south west of Balerno, at the south west end of Harperrig Reservoir, in West Lothian, Scotland. Cairns Castle is situated 2 miles east of Over Williamston.

West Calder
Village
Photo: Brideshead, Public domain.
West Calder is a village in the council area of West Lothian, Scotland, located four miles west of Livingston. Historically it is within the County of Midlothian. West Calder is situated 2½ miles west of Over Williamston.
Livingston
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Livingston is a large town in West Lothian in the central belt of Scotland, built as a "New Town" from 1963. In 2022 it had a population of 55,800.
Livingston Village
Suburb
Photo: Jim Smillie,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Livingston Village is a village in West Lothian, dating back to the 12th century. Originally a farming village in the county of West Lothian, it is now in the heart of the town of Livingston. Livingston Village is situated 3½ miles north of Over Williamston.
